Generate Schematic, Layout and Gerber files of a simple existing relay controller PCB
Project details
I am developing a prototype for my home automation product and need help with reverse engineering an existing PCB that I want to replicate.
The PCB is a simple Relay Controller. It has an onboard Microcontroller (PIC/Atmel) that controls 12 onboard Sugar Cube Relays (5VDC / 230VAC@5A) using its GPIOs and Relay Drivers (ULNxxx). The PCB has a female berg-strip provision to mount an ESP-12E NodeMCU. The NodeMCU and the onboard Microcontroller are connected for UART communication (RX-TX, TX-RX). The NodeMCU sends commands to the Microcontroller instructing which Relays should be switched on and off (Commands list will be provided). The PCB is powered by a Hi-link HLK-PM05 supply module.
Photographs of existing PCB and a block diagram of the required PCB will be provided to the Freelancer.
The project is urgent and we require Microcontroller firmware code + basic guide on how to program it, Schematics, Layout and Gerber files for manufacturing the PCB.
